I suppose they can, if they are actively searching for the markers these items leave behind. You would have to work in a field where it would matter, and then you would be positive they check for them and would not need to ask the question. If you are worried about the normal, random drug tests most workplaces give their employees, then no. They will not show up on the tests because they are looking for things like pot, cocaine, etc.

When testing for the big five (opiates, amphetamines, cocaine, cannibinoids, phencyclidine) it will not show up in a drug screen unless tested for it specifically, and that never happens. (on pre-employment screening) Some sites have said it could pop a fake positive for amphetamines, but trust me when I say this is NOT true, it's a completely different class drug.
